Mombasa governor Ali Hassan Joho and his opponent Nyali MP Hezron Awiti (R), at a past function. [Photo: Courtesy]Mombasa governor Ali Hassan Joho has filed a case against his rival, Nyali MP Hezron Awiti, over campaign billboards.
According to Joho, Awiti who is using the Vibrant Democratic Party (VDP) to unseat him, mounted a billboard in Mombasa, without approval of the county government authorities.
Mombasa City Court Principal Magistrate CN Ndegwa gave summons, directing Awiti to appear before the court, Friday morning, June 30, to answer to the charges.
This even as Joho is accused of blocking his rivals, Awiti and Jubilee Party's Suleiman Shahbal, from mounting campaign billboards in the Coastal town.
They want Joho investigated on claims that he is bribing billboard companies to reject their tenders to mount billboards to advertise their candidature against Joho, an ODM (Nasa) governor.
The county government has however dismissed the accusations.
